Facebook

  • The average Facebook user has 130 friends.
  • More than 25 billion pieces of content (web links, news stories, blog posts, notes, photo albums, etc.) is shared each month.
  • Over 300,000 users helped translate the site through the translations application.
  • More than 150 million people engage with Facebook on external websites every month.
  • Two-thirds of comScore’s U.S. Top 100 websites and half of comScore’s Global Top 100 websites have integrated with Facebook.
  • There are more than 100 million active users currently accessing Facebook through their mobile devices.
  • People that access Facebook via mobile are twice as active than non-mobile users (think about that when designing your Facebook page).
  • The average Facebook user is connected to 60 pages, groups and events.
  • People spend over 500 billion minutes per month on Facebook.
  • There are more than 1 million entrepreneurs and developers from 180 countries on Facebook.

Statistics from Facebook press office.

Twitter

  • Twitter’s web platform only accounts for a quarter of its users – 75% use third-party apps.
  • Twitter gets more than 300,000 new users every day.
  • There are currently 110 million users of Twitter’s services.
  • Twitter receives 180 million unique visits each month.
  • There are more than 600 million searches on Twitter every day.
  • Twitter started as a simple SMS-text service.
  • Over 60% of Twitter use is outside the U.S.
  • There are more than 50,000 third-party apps for Twitter.
  • Twitter has donated access to all of its tweets to the Library of Congress for research and preservation.
  • More than a third of users access Twitter via their mobile phone.

Statistics from Twitter and the Chirp Conference.

LinkedIn

  • LinkedIn is the oldest of the four sites in this post, having been created on May 5 2003.
  • There are more than 70 million users worldwide.
  • Members of LinkedIn come from more than 200 countries from every continent.
  • LinkedIn is available in six native languages – English, French, German, Italian, Portuguese and Spanish.
  • Oracle’s Chief Financial Officer, Jeff Epstein, was headhunted for the position via his LinkedIn profile.
  • 80% of companies use LinkedIn as a recruitment tool.
  • A new member joins LinkedIn every second.
  • LinkedIn receives almost 12 million unique visitors per day.
  • Executives from all Fortune 500 companies are on LinkedIn.
  • Recruiters account for 1-in-20 LinkedIn profiles.

Statistics from LinkedIn press centre and SysComm International.

YouTube

  • The very first video uploaded was called “Me at the Zoo”, on 23rd April 2005.
  • By June 2006, more than 65,000 videos were being uploaded every day.
  • YouTube receives more than 2 billion viewers per day.
  • Every minute, 24 hours of video is uploaded to YouTube.
  • The U.S. accounts for 70% of YouTube users.
  • Over half of YouTube’s users are under 20 years old.
  • You would need to live for around 1,000 years to watch all the videos currently on YouTube.
  • YouTube is available in 19 countries and 12 languages.
  • Music videos account for 20% of uploads.
  • YouTube uses the same amount of bandwidth as the entire Internet used in 2000.

Statistics from YouTube press center.

Blogging

  •   77% of Internet users read blogs.• There are currently 133 million blogs listed on leading blog directory Technorati.
  • 60% of bloggers are between the ages 18-44.
  • One in five bloggers update their blogs daily.
  • Two thirds of bloggers are male.
  • Corporate blogging accounts for 14% of blogs.
  • 15% of bloggers spend 10 hours a week blogging.
  • More than half of all bloggers are married and/or parents.
  • More than 50% of bloggers have more than one blog.
  • Bloggers use an average of five different social sites to drive traffic to their blog.

Statistics from Technorati’s State of the Blogosphere 2009.
